Question

  1. consider the graph of line m.

a. which pair of points can be used to draw a slope triangle for line m? choose all that apply.
a. (-8,4) and (-4,5)
b. (-8,4) and (0,6)
c. (-8,4) and (8,8)
d. (-4,5) and (0,6)
e. (0,6) and (8,8)
b. choose one correct pair of points from part (a). draw a slope triangle by using these points.
c. find the slope of line m.

Explanation:

Step1: Recall slope - triangle concept

Any two points on the line can be used to form a slope - triangle.

Step2: Check each option

  • For option A: The points (-8,4) and (-4,5) lie on the line.
  • For option B: The points (-8,4) and (0,6) lie on the line.
  • For option C: The points (-8,4) and (8,8) lie on the line.
  • For option D: The points (-4,5) and (0,6) lie on the line.
  • For option E: The points (0,6) and (8,8) lie on the line.

So all options A, B, C, D, E are correct for part a.

Step3: Choose a pair for part b

Let's choose (-8,4) and (0,6)

Step4: Recall slope formula

The slope formula is $m=\frac{y_2 - y_1}{x_2 - x_1}$

Step5: Calculate the slope for part c

Let $(x_1,y_1)=(-8,4)$ and $(x_2,y_2)=(0,6)$
$m=\frac{6 - 4}{0-(-8)}=\frac{2}{8}=\frac{1}{4}$

Answer:

a. A. (-8,4) and (-4,5), B. (-8,4) and (0,6), C. (-8,4) and (8,8), D. (-4,5) and (0,6), E. (0,6) and (8,8)
b. (Choose (-8,4) and (0,6) to draw a slope - triangle. In a graph, plot the two points, draw a horizontal line from (-8,4) and a vertical line from (0,6) to form a right - triangle)
c. $\frac{1}{4}$
